 I am having out of memory issues when transforming my FO - PDF using
 fop-0.20.5rc2. I read that using multiple page sequences in the XSL and

There is a production release of 0.20.5

 therefore in the FO means that fop will release some memory. I don't see how
 I can do this. My XML file is generated dynamically from a database so I
 don't know how big it will be. Is there any solutions I can use that uses
 multiple page sequences or possible change the xml structure, if not is
 there another FOP transformer that isn't as memory intensive. Thanks in
 advanced for any help. If I havn't provided enough info please ask and I can
 get back to you.

2004-03-12 Thread Fabrizio Tringali
Hi Brett,
It's not about faith, spanning datas across multiple page sequences 
brings an huge memory saving.
We solve issue of constant OutOfMemory errors (according to heap 
allocation) going to about 2 MB memory consumption on fully written 100 
pages documents.

You have to identify where in your document could be inserted a page break
or
decide to break intentionally after N rows of datas (1 record on your XML 
file can be M rows on document so M*N is the total rows on document)

In the second case put logic for break when ciclying your datas templates 
using something like this ($STOP is max number of data rows for page):

xsl:for-each select=DATA_ROW[position() mod $STOP = 1]
fo:page-sequence master-reference=YOUR_MASTER_REFERENCE 
initial-page-number=auto
fo:flow flow-name=xsl-region-body
fo:table table-layout=fixed width=480pt
fo:table-column column-width=85pt/
fo:table-column column-width=15pt/
fo:table-body
fo:table-row line-height=30pt
fo:table-cell
fo:block 
text-align=center font-size=10pt font-family=Couriertitle 1/fo:block
/fo:table-cell
fo:table-cell
fo:block 
text-align=center font-size=10pt font-family=Couriertitle 2/fo:block
/fo:table-cell
/fo:table-row
   /fo:table-body
/fo:table
xsl:for-each 
select=.|following-sibling::DATA_ROW[position() lt; $STOP]
xsl:apply-templates select=./
/xsl:for-each
/fo:flow
/fo:page-sequence
/xsl:for-each

xsl:template match=DATA_ROW
fo:table table-layout=fixed width=480pt
fo:table-column column-width=85pt/
fo:table-column column-width=10pt/
fo:table-body
fo:table-row line-height=13pt
fo:table-cell
fo:block text-align=left 
font-size=10pt font-family=Courier
xsl:value-of 
select=YOUR_ROW_KEY_1/
/fo:block
/fo:table-cell
fo:table-cell
fo:block text-align=center 
font-size=10pt font-family=Courier
xsl:value-of 
select=YOUR_ROW_KEY_2/
/fo:block
/fo:table-cell
/fo:table-row
/fo:table-body
/fo:table
/xsl:template

I asked about memory on the machine and about the command line arguments
used to invoke your environment as a sanity-check to make sure that your
Java VM (in this case Tomcat ?) is configured with a large enough heap
to support your program. It could explain why your application runs out
of heap. There are reasons WHY it requires this much memory, that we
don't want to go in to here.

Simply plugging in a few memory cards isn't enough. Java has to know the
size of the heap (free store) that it is allowed to create. For the Sun
Java, use the commands: java -j  and java -X to see the options.

In Tomcat 5, you could use the environment variable JAVA_OPTS to pass
in a value for -Xmx, say JAVA_OPTS=-Xmx800M to  allow an 800 Mb heap.

This isn't a perfect solution, but it could help you get to the next
level and keep you alive while you consider your commercial options.
